How does starch produce in leaves?

Starch is produced in leaves through the process of photosynthesis. This process involves sunlight, carbon dioxide, and water being converted into glucose, which is then polymerized into starch for storage. The starch provides an energy reserve for the plant to use when needed.

Cycle that involves transpiration?

The water cycle involves transpiration as plants release water vapor through their leaves, which contributes to the overall water vapor in the atmosphere. This water vapor then condenses to form clouds and eventually falls back to the Earth as precipitation. The water is then taken up by plants again, continuing the cycle.


What are earths three cycles?

The three cycles on Earth are the water cycle, carbon cycle, and nitrogen cycle. The water cycle involves the continuous movement of water on, above, and below the surface of the Earth. The carbon cycle involves the movement of carbon between living organisms, the atmosphere, oceans, and the Earth's crust. The nitrogen cycle involves the processes by which nitrogen is converted and circulated in the environment.
